Today's carry is another "Serpentine Jack". This one is a Taylor-Schrade 93 OT. I'm quite partial to this knife. I did need to thin the point on the clip to give it an actual point, but other than that it is well made. The combination of sheepsfoot and California Clip allows the nail nicks to be on the same side, something I wish Case would do with more of their patterns. (with apologies to left handed knife knuts.)

To add to what Tyson A Wright Tyson A Wright was trying to show you about the Middle Pin in the covers and then show you the proper location of the Pivot Pin which must be above and below the Arrow depending on which side you are looking at . Mark Side = Above and Pile Side = Below .
IdKfAfI.jpg

The Original Russells And Stamp of RUSSELL was in a Straight Line . I can not see yours much at all but it appears that it maybe be in an Arch . If it is then there are a few other Tell Tales . The Arched Stamp was started in approx. 1934 .
There were some Fake Russells made but there also were some Commemorative ones made with no pretense of being real Russells . In this photo the one on the Left and the top 3 in the Middle . I hope this helps you some . Congrats on finding what I expect is after 1933 real Russell that has barely been used .
